-
Foreign Key Django, For example, creating an Article with unsaved Reporter raises 本記事ではdjangoのモデルにおける、リレーションフィールド(ForeignKey、OneToOneField、ManyToManyField)について詳しく解説し ところが、どうもDjangoだと外部キー絡みのモデル上の使用制限とsqliteの仕様によって、大変な苦労を強いられました。 それからDjangoで混乱要素は、データベース作成のため Djangoでは、ForeignKeyフィールドを用いて外部キーのリレーションを作成可能で、to_fieldパラメータで関連付けるフィールドを指定できる。 例えば、モデル Model1 と Model2 が DjangoではForeignKey (多対一) やManyToMany (多対多) といったフィールドを使って、モデル同士を紐づかせることが可能です。 ただ、私自身 In the simplest terms, a Foreign Key in Django creates a many-to-one relationship between two models. pyを修正するかの入 本日は、Modelについての補足記事(第二弾)になります。 Django開発においてモデル設計は非常に重要です。 特に適切なリレーション(関連)の選択はアプリケーションのパ Django Rest Frameworkで関連モデルをAPIレスポンスに含めるには? Django Rest Framework(DRF)は、Web APIを作るのに本当に便利なん . The foreign key 外部キー制約をつけたので、nullを許容したくないのですが、既存のカラムになにかデータを入れる必要がありました。 一時的なデフォルト値を設定するかmodels. db import models from django. Django の外部キーについての日本語の情報は、ネットでも豊富ではありません。 外部キーの使い方は基本必修項目なのだろうと思います。 簡単なチュートリアルを作成しました。 複数のデータベースを相互に関連付ける方法を手軽に知りたい、という人向きです。 ねこの名前のテーブルと、好きな 1-1. This means many rows in one table can be 検索やフィルタリングが頻繁に行われるフィールドには、インデックスを設定することでクエリのパフォーマンスを向上させることができます。 Djangoでは、フィールド定義時に [ 【Django】トランザクション上でマスタ上の参照コードを取得する場合にForeign keyを使い地獄を見た話 Python Django MySQL SQLite3 Your intermediate model must contain one - and only one - foreign key to the source model (this would be Group in our example), or you must explicitly specify the DjangoではForeignKey (多対一) やManyToMany (多対多) といったフィールドを使って、モデル同士を紐づかせることが可能です。 ただ、私自身 Djangoの解説サイトではForeignKeyのrelated_nameについて解説していることがあまりないです。本記事ではDjangoにおける、ForeignKeyの引 Djangoでは、ForeignKeyフィールドを用いて外部キーのリレーションを作成可能で、to_fieldパラメータで関連付けるフィールドを指定できる。 例えば、モデル Model1 と Model2 が はじめに Djangoのdjango-import-exportを使って、管理画面でデータをインポートする方法を調べました。 今回インポートするモデルに How to Create Foreign Key Relationships in Django Admin The Django admin handles ForeignKeys well. モデルを紐づけるリレーションフィールド ForeignKey は Django のモデル間を紐づけるリレーションフィールドの一つです。 Django のモデルには以下の3種類のリレーション Django の外部キーについての日本語の情報は、ネットでも豊富ではありません。 外部キーの使い方は基本必修項目なのだろうと思います。 簡単なチュートリアルを作成しました。 複 こんにちは、プログラミング学習、お疲れ様です! Djangoの外部キーを使ったフィルタリング、ちょっと戸惑いますよね。 でもご安心ください Note that you must save an object before it can be assigned to a foreign key relationship. If you’ve got both Post and Comment モデルで、Primary Key を使うようにした時の ForeignKey の使い方です。 models. u Djangoで外部キーを使うにはmodelに一対多のForeignKey 一対一のOneToOneFieldを指定する。 ここでは親モデルのUser, 子モデルのDataを作成することを考える。 データベース定義 djangoで、クライアント(ブラウザ側)から受け取ったフォームをデータベースに登録する際、表記のエラーが表示されました。このエラーを回避するには、ForeignKeyのカラムかど Python - Djangoで外部キー属性のデフォルト値を設定する モデルの外部キーのフィールドにデフォルト値を設定する最良の方法は何ですか? 例えば、2つのモデル Student と Exam があり、Student 本記事ではdjangoのモデルにおける、リレーションフィールド(ForeignKey、OneToOneField、ManyToManyField)について詳しく解説し How is Django ForeignKey saved to the database? ForeignKey saves, as the name suggests, the foreign key to the database. u モデルで、Primary Key を使うようにした時の ForeignKey の使い方です。 models. py to_field を指定する必要があります。 models. py from django. 6eb9, mmy, hjal, xfntkvqbq, z6auv74, upt6qz, vpby, oxh, 3a9c, fktx, 1ir, nxxa, kcsqux, hcjb, r16, 78x5usy, fgxa, lswiuk, 6r8, wlgqho, nx0lp, hv, 8li, pf7t, js8h1, rdt, habss8i, bt11yy6, d4skty, yqm2h,